This is an old revision of the document!


Как развернуть картинку без перекодирования видеофайла

Иногда так случается, что видеоролик начинаешь снимать из вертикального положения, но продолжаешь снимать горизонтально. В итоге файл записыватся вертикальным, но с горизонтальной картинкой.
В с помошью утилиты ffmpeg можно внести изменения в метаданные файла, что позволит просматривать его в нужной ориентации без перекодирования.
Команда такая:

ffmpeg -i input.mp4 -c copy -metadata:s:v:0 rotate=90 output_rotated.mp4

или

ffmpeg -i input.m4v -map_metadata 0 -metadata:s:v rotate="90" -codec copy output.m4v
Enter your comment. Wiki syntax is allowed:
 
  • linux_faq/rotate_video_without_re_encoding.1633261326.txt
  • Last modified: 2021/10/03 11:42
  • by admin